The Massachusetts Department of Public Health (MDPH) is the principal agency for emergency medical services in the Commonwealth, under Mass. General Laws Chapter 111C, 3(b). Under statute, MGL c. 111C, 4 and 5, MDPH is directed to enter into contracts with Regional EMS Councils, in order that these Councils can carry out the duties and functions charged to them in accordance with the statute, the EMS System regulations at 105 CMR 170.104, and as set out in the contract itself.

MDPHs Office of Emergency Medical Services is providing this notice of intent to award contracts under 815 CMR 2.00 to Regional EMS Councils via contractual agreement in order to meet the requirements of Mass. General Laws chapter 111C, 4 and 5.
